Swansea vs Cardiff 2021-22 English League Championship, Regular Season

Match Commentary
- 26': Leandro Bacuna (Cardiff City)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 29': Goal! Swansea City 1, Cardiff City 0. Jamie Paterson (Swansea City) right footed shot from outside the box to the bottom right corner. Assisted by Ryan Manning.
- 45'+3': First Half ends, Swansea City 1, Cardiff City 0.
- 45': Second Half begins Swansea City 1, Cardiff City 0.
- 60': Goal! Swansea City 2, Cardiff City 0. Joël Piroe (Swansea City) right footed shot from the centre of the box to the bottom left corner. Assisted by Jamie Paterson with a through ball.
- 63': Ryan Manning (Swansea City) is shown the yellow card.
- 67': Substitution, Swansea City. Olivier Ntcham replaces Korey Smith.
- 68': Substitution, Cardiff City. James Collins replaces Leandro Bacuna because of an injury.
- 74': Goal! Swansea City 3, Cardiff City 0. Jake Bidwell (Swansea City) header from very close range to the top left corner. Assisted by Jamie Paterson.
- 80': Substitution, Cardiff City. Rubin Colwill replaces Ciaron Brown.
- 81': Substitution, Swansea City. Ben Cabango replaces Ryan Bennett.
- 84': Substitution, Cardiff City. Will Vaulks replaces Joe Ralls.
- 85': Substitution, Swansea City. Liam Cullen replaces Joël Piroe.
- 90'+1': Will Vaulks (Cardiff City)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 90'+3': Second Half ends, Swansea City 3, Cardiff City 0.
